Hidden Dangers of Vein Disease

Medical experts recognize that superficial cosmetic issues with varicose veins often conceal deeper systemic problems within the vascular system. Vein disease requires proper medical intervention since its untreated condition allows multiple medical problems to appear.

Chronic Venous Insufficiency develops when the heart receives inadequate blood circulation through the leg veins, leading to symptoms including swelling and pain, as well as the formation of varicose veins.

Deep Vein Thrombosis exists as a life-threatening condition that produces blood clots inside deep veins in the legs. The presence of any vein disease condition makes you more susceptible to developing DVT due to the risk of dangerous pulmonary embolism (PE) from broken clots in your lungs.

Leg Ulcers and Skin Changes: The formation of skin sores on the legs constitutes a major complication of venous disease, known as Leg Ulcers and Skin Breakdown. The condition of ulcers remains both difficult to heal and vulnerable to possible infections. The poor functioning of veins weakens blood flow, which can lead to skin damage and result in open sores throughout the body.

Bleeding: The rupture of large varicose veins often ends in severe bleeding episodes. The condition becomes dangerous because any damage to shallow veins in the skin layer can trigger ruptures that require urgent medical care.

The Recognition Signs of Vein Disease

Proper medical intervention requires noticing the early indicators of vein disease. Common symptoms include:

●    The feet and legs display swelling along with the ankles.

●    Every day, standing can cause the legs to feel heavy, even after prolonged periods.

●    Excessively visible, bulging veins on the legs (i.e., varicose veins)

●    Leg pain includes both tightness and burning sensations, as well as itching experiences in the legs when the veins are present.

●    Skin changes (i.e., ulcers)
